Common Causes

Tennis Elbow (Lateral Epicondylitis). Degeneration of the tendons on the outer elbow, driven by repetitive gripping, lifting, and wrist extension. It causes pain on the outside of the elbow that worsens with grasping.
 

Golfer’s Elbow (Medial Epicondylitis). The same tendon breakdown on the inner elbow, common with repetitive flexion and rotation, producing pain along the inside of the joint and into the forearm.

When Typical Treatments Fail
 

Many patients find that physical therapy, cortisone shots, and anti-inflammatories provide only temporary relief. These methods often mask symptoms without addressing the underlying tissue degeneration.
 

Corticosteroid Injections: offer rapid relief but can weaken tendons over time, working against the very tissue that needs to heal.
 

NSAIDs & Painkillers: manage daily discomfort but carry systemic side effects and do not repair the tendon.
 

Physical Therapy Alone: vital for mobility, yet often unable to repair structural tendon damage in stubborn cases.
 

Surgical Intervention: invasive, with meaningful downtime and inherent surgical risk.
